EOS Technical Analysis: EOS/USD sitting on the edge of a cliff, down 10%

  • EOS price is nursing heavy losses in the session on Thursday, down some 10%.
  • EOS/USD price flirting with the psychological $3 level to the downside.
  • Price is supported by a near-term trend line, if breached, price could free-fall.

EOS/USD 60-minute chart

 

 

Spot rate:                  2.9409

Relative change:      -9.63%

High:                         3.3264

Low:                          2.9100

Trend:                        Bearish

Support 1:                  2.9600, near-term ascending trend line.

Support 2:                  2.8672, 27 November low.

Support 3:                  2.8050, daily pivot point support. 

Resistance 1:             3.1300, 60-minute resistance.

Resistance 2:             3.4011, 28 November high.

Resistance 3:             3.5000, 60-minute resistance.
